Output 1ecb3753c61379126271a3202fecbc227765359538d106cc2a85750742023995:0

value
1045041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66975986b9632fdf8652e11861aef193c7cd9ca OP_EQUAL
address
3Q9vVBK8a1bRTE2QRn9HQSU8tFE366t5qE
transaction
1ecb3753c61379126271a3202fecbc227765359538d106cc2a85750742023995
spent
true